Guidance on Selecting Appropriate Attire

The following points offer advice on choosing an item of clothing that emulates a juvenile gallinaceous bird, specifically designed for young boys.

Tip 1: Prioritize Fabric Safety: Opt for materials certified as hypoallergenic and free from harmful chemicals. The sensitive skin of infants requires textiles that minimize the risk of irritation or allergic reaction.

Tip 2: Assess Construction Quality: Examine seams and closures for durability. Reinforcements at stress points, such as around leg openings and fasteners, ensure the outfit withstands typical infant movements.

Tip 3: Verify Size Accuracy: Consult sizing charts and consider the infant’s current measurements, not just their age. A comfortably fitting garment allows for unrestricted movement and prevents overheating.

Tip 4: Evaluate Ease of Dressing and Changing: Select designs with strategically placed snaps or zippers for convenient diaper changes. Minimize the need for complicated maneuvering to reduce stress on both the infant and caregiver.

Tip 5: Inspect Embellishments for Security: Confirm that any decorative elements, such as eyes or wattles, are securely attached. Loose pieces pose a choking hazard and should be avoided.

Tip 6: Consider Seasonal Appropriateness: Choose lighter-weight fabrics for warmer climates and heavier materials for colder environments. Layering may be necessary to maintain the infant’s comfort.

Tip 7: Review Care Instructions: Prioritize machine-washable fabrics for ease of cleaning.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ions to prevent damage to the garment during laundering.

Adherence to these guidelines ensures the selection of a safe, comfortable, and appropriately sized item, providing a positive experience for both the infant and their caregivers.

1. Comfort and Safety

1. Comfort And Safety, Outfit

Comfort and safety are paramount considerations in the design and selection of any infant garment, especially novelty items. Apparel resembling a juvenile gallinaceous bird requires specific attention to these factors to prevent potential harm or discomfort to the wearer.

  • Material Composition

    The choice of fabric directly impacts comfort and safety. Natural fibers like cotton are preferable due to their breathability and reduced risk of skin irritation. Synthetic materials, if used, must be tested for hypoallergenic properties and the absence of harmful chemicals such as formaldehyde. Poor material choices can lead to overheating, rashes, or allergic reactions.

  • Design and Construction

    The garment’s design must prioritize ease of movement and prevent entanglement hazards. Loose strings, ribbons, or small, detachable parts pose a choking risk and should be avoided. Seams should be smooth and flat to prevent chafing against the infant’s delicate skin. Restrictive designs can hinder breathing or circulation.

  • Thermal Regulation

    Infants have limited ability to regulate their body temperature. Overly insulated or poorly ventilated attire can lead to overheating, while inadequate protection can result in hypothermia. The design should allow for layering to adjust to varying environmental conditions. Breathable materials are crucial for preventing excessive heat buildup.

  • Closure Mechanisms

    Fasteners such as snaps or zippers must be securely attached and positioned to prevent pinching or scratching. Snaps should be lead-free and durable enough to withstand repeated use. Zippers should have fabric guards to protect the infant’s skin from contact with the metal teeth. Poorly designed closures can cause discomfort and potential injury.

2. Appropriate Sizing

2. Appropriate Sizing, Outfit

The correct dimensions are critical when selecting attire designed to resemble a juvenile gallinaceous bird for infant males. Ill-fitting clothing can negatively impact the infant’s comfort, safety, and overall experience. An oversized garment may present entanglement hazards, restricting movement and potentially leading to falls. Conversely, an undersized costume can constrict circulation, impede breathing, and cause skin irritation due to friction and pressure. Consequently, accurate sizing is not merely a matter of aesthetics but a fundamental safety consideration.

Sizing discrepancies frequently arise due to variations in manufacturer standards. A “3-6 month” size from one brand may differ significantly from another. Therefore, relying solely on age-based sizing is inadequate. Measuring the infant’s chest circumference, torso length, and inseam provides a more accurate basis for selection. Comparing these measurements against the specific sizing chart provided by the garment manufacturer is essential. Moreover, accounting for diaper bulk is crucial to ensure adequate room in the crotch area, preventing discomfort and potential skin chafing. Choosing garments with adjustable features, such as snaps or hook-and-loop closures, enables a more customized fit. For example, a costume with adjustable shoulder straps or an elasticized waistband can accommodate variations in the infant’s body shape and size.

3. Material Quality

3. Material Quality, Outfit

The selection of materials for garments designed to resemble a juvenile fowl intended for infant males constitutes a critical factor influencing safety, comfort, and durability. Material quality dictates the garment’s ability to withstand wear and tear, resist potential hazards, and provide a comfortable experience for the wearer. The following facets explore key aspects of material quality relevant to such attire.

  • Fiber Content and Composition

    The specific fibers used, whether natural (e.g., cotton, bamboo) or synthetic (e.g., polyester, acrylic), determine breathability, absorbency, and potential for allergic reactions. Natural fibers generally offer superior breathability and moisture absorption, reducing the risk of skin irritation. Conversely, some synthetic fibers may trap heat and moisture, creating an environment conducive to bacterial growth. A costume crafted from 100% organic cotton minimizes exposure to pesticides and other harmful chemicals, thereby reducing the potential for adverse reactions in infants with sensitive skin. Costumes using low-grade polyester may lead to overheating and discomfort.

  • Dye Toxicity and Safety

    The dyes used to color the fabric must be non-toxic and free from heavy metals or other harmful substances. Infants are prone to mouthing objects, increasing the risk of ingesting dye residue. Garments certified by organizations like OEKO-TEX ensure that the dyes used meet stringent safety standards and pose minimal risk to the wearer. Costumes using substandard dyes may leach color, potentially staining the infant’s skin or causing allergic contact dermatitis.

  • Fabric Weight and Weave

    The weight and weave of the fabric influence its durability, drape, and thermal properties. A tightly woven fabric provides greater resistance to tearing and abrasion, ensuring the garment withstands repeated wear and washing. Lighter-weight fabrics are more breathable, while heavier fabrics offer greater insulation. For example, a costume made from a lightweight, tightly woven cotton fabric provides both durability and breathability, suitable for warmer climates. A loosely woven, heavier fabric might prove too warm and uncomfortable.

  • Flame Resistance and Regulatory Compliance

    While not always mandatory, flame resistance is a desirable characteristic, particularly for garments intended for children. Fabrics treated with flame-retardant chemicals offer increased protection in the event of accidental exposure to fire. Adherence to relevant safety regulations, such as those established by the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C), ensures that the garment meets minimum safety standards. A costume that complies with CPSC regulations demonstrates a commitment to safety and reduces the risk of injury from fire.

4. Design Durability

4. Design Durability, Outfit

The inherent resilience of the design is a critical factor when considering infant apparel, especially novelty items such as those styled to resemble a juvenile gallinaceous bird. This characteristic determines the garment’s capacity to withstand the stresses of repeated wear, washing, and the generally active behavior of infants. Without adequate durability, the item will quickly degrade, diminishing its value and potentially posing safety risks.

  • Seam Strength and Construction

    Reinforced seams are essential to prevent tearing or unraveling, particularly at stress points such as armholes, leg openings, and crotch seams. The use of high-quality thread and appropriate stitch density contributes significantly to seam strength. For example, a costume with double-stitched and serged seams will withstand more rigorous use compared to one with single-stitched, unsecured seams. Inadequate seam construction results in premature failure and potential hazards.

  • Fastener Integrity

    Snaps, zippers, and hook-and-loop closures must be securely attached and capable of withstanding repeated use. Low-quality fasteners can detach easily, posing a choking hazard or rendering the garment unusable. The use of reinforced backing or durable materials for fasteners ensures long-term functionality. A costume utilizing high-quality, securely fastened snaps will offer greater reliability and safety than one with easily dislodged closures.

  • Fabric Resistance to Abrasion and Pilling

    The fabric should resist abrasion from contact with surfaces and pilling from friction. Durable fabrics retain their appearance and structural integrity even after multiple washings and wearings. A costume constructed from a tightly woven, abrasion-resistant fabric will maintain its aesthetic appeal and functionality for a longer period compared to one made from a loosely woven, delicate material. Excessive pilling detracts from the garment’s appearance and reduces its overall lifespan.

  • Colorfastness and Resistance to Fading

    The dyes used in the fabric must be colorfast, resisting fading or bleeding during washing and exposure to sunlight. Color fading diminishes the garment’s visual appeal and may indicate the use of substandard dyes. A costume utilizing high-quality, colorfast dyes will retain its vibrancy and aesthetic appeal even after repeated laundering and exposure to environmental elements. Faded or discolored costumes lose their novelty and visual impact.

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Infant Apparel Designed to Resemble a Juvenile Gallinaceous Bird

The following section addresses common inquiries and concerns related to the selection, use, and safety of novelty attire styled to resemble a young domesticated fowl, specifically intended for infant males.

Question 1: What are the primary safety considerations when selecting such attire?

Primary safety considerations include the absence of small, detachable parts that pose a choking hazard, the use of non-toxic dyes and materials to prevent skin irritation or allergic reactions, and the overall design minimizing entanglement risks. Garments should also allow for adequate ventilation to prevent overheating.

Question 2: What materials are most suitable for this type of infant apparel?

Natural, breathable fabrics such as cotton, particularly organic cotton, are generally considered most suitable. These materials minimize the risk of skin irritation and allow for adequate air circulation. Synthetic materials, if used, should be hypoallergenic and free from harmful chemicals.

Question 3: How can the appropriate size be determined to ensure a comfortable and safe fit?

Relying solely on age-based sizing is insufficient. Measuring the infant’s chest circumference, torso length, and inseam, then comparing these measurements to the manufacturer’s specific sizing chart, provides a more accurate fit. Account for diaper bulk and choose garments with adjustable features when possible.

Question 4: What are the recommended care instructions to maintain the garment’s quality and safety?

Following the manufacturer’s specific care instructions is paramount. Machine washing with a gentle detergent and tumble drying on low heat are generally recommended. Avoid using bleach or harsh chemicals that may damage the fabric or compromise the non-toxic nature of the dyes.

Question 5: Are there any specific design features to avoid in this type of novelty attire?

Avoid garments with long, loose strings, ribbons, or dangling embellishments that could pose an entanglement or strangulation hazard. Ensure that any appliqus or decorations are securely attached and cannot be easily removed by the infant.

Question 6: What are the potential risks associated with prolonged use of such attire?

Prolonged use of any garment, including novelty apparel, can lead to overheating, skin irritation, or restriction of movement if the garment is ill-fitting or made from non-breathable materials. Regular monitoring of the infant’s comfort and skin condition is advised.
